General Manager, Men's Basketball
Position Summary
Under the general supervision of the Men’s Basketball Head Coach and Athletics Department leadership, the General Manager of Men’s Basketball serves as the senior strategic leader responsible for roster construction, financial planning, NIL and revenue-share strategy, and external partnerships. This position oversees two full-time staff members (Director of Player Development and Recruiting and Director of Scouting and Strategy) and functions as the primary bridge between basketball operations, compliance, marketing, and third-party NIL partners.
